Eastview Terrace


Eastview Terrace houses 806 upperclass students in seven residence halls. Each student has a single room with a private bath, and each floor is clustered into houses made up of 8 to 22 student rooms.

A study/social space and laundry facilities are located in each house. Students can choose to live in either a single-gender or coed house.

Dining facilities and mail service are available in nearby Redifer Commons, which features South Food District (a food court with a coffee shop, a deli, and other eateries) and Redifer Dining Commons. All Eastview Terrace residents enjoy the benefits of Penn State’s Campus Meal Plan.

Eastview Terrace is just a short distance from Bryce Jordan Center, Beaver Stadium, McCoy Natatorium (swimming pools), tennis courts, the varsity track and field facility, Greenberg Indoor Sports Complex (an ice-skating rink), Eisenhower Auditorium, HUB-Robeson Center, and downtown State College. CATA bus stops are also nearby.

Brill Hall, located off McKean Road, houses administrative offices and the Eastview Terrace Commons Desk. A Residential Computing (ResCom) Office is located in nearby Redifer Commons—and is staffed by students who are experienced in assisting with various computer issues.
